Understand what growth services do
Not all growth services are scams. Some offer legit help like analytics tools, scheduling platforms, engagement tips, or even human-powered outreach. The shady ones are the ones that promise fake followers, fake likes, or fake comments.
If a service sounds too good to be true, it probably is. Always start by reading what they actually do. Is it helping you reach more real people or just inflating your numbers with bots?
Stick to platform-approved tools
Every major platform has a list of approved partners. These tools follow the platform’s API rules. They don’t try to cheat the system. Services like scheduling apps, analytics dashboards, or even CRM tools for social media are usually safe.
Before signing up, check if the tool is mentioned on the platform’s website or blog. Using approved tools keeps your account secure and your growth real.
Avoid fake engagement at all costs
Buying likes or followers? Don’t. These fake numbers might look cool for a day, but they ruin your long-term performance. Platforms are smarter now. They can spot fake engagement quickly. And once your account is flagged, it’s hard to recover.
Instead, focus on tools that help you get seen by real people. Tools that improve reach, not fake your success.
Use automation wisely
Some growth services offer automation. Auto-comments, auto-follows, auto-messages. Sounds easy, but it’s risky. Platforms limit how many actions you can take in a day. If you cross the line, you’ll get blocked.
If you use automation, keep it slow and human-like. Limit the number of actions. Personalize messages. Don’t just spam people. Better yet, mix automation with real interaction. That way, you stay under the radar.
Always read the platform’s rules
Every platform has community guidelines and terms of service. They update them often. Read them. Know them. Stay within the lines. Ignorance won’t protect you if you get flagged.
